Preguntas etiquetadas con c++

159
Cómo imprimir en la consola cuando se usa Qt

Estoy usando Qt4 y C ++ para hacer algunos programas en gráficos de computadora. Necesito poder imprimir algunas variables en mi consola en tiempo de ejecución, sin depurar, pero coutparece que no funciona incluso si agrego las bibliotecas. ¿Hay alguna forma de hacer

159
El método más rápido de captura de pantalla en Windows

Quiero escribir un programa de screencasting para la plataforma Windows, pero no estoy seguro de cómo capturar la pantalla. El único método que conozco es usar GDI, pero tengo curiosidad por saber si hay otras formas de hacerlo, y si las hay, ¿cuál incurre en la menor sobrecarga? La velocidad es...

158
Cómo utilizar la API de socket C en C ++ en z / OS

Estoy teniendo problemas para conseguir la API de sockets C para que funcione correctamente en C++el z/OS. Aunque lo estoy incluyendo sys/socket.h, todavía recibo errores de tiempo de compilación que me dicen que AF_INETno está definido . ¿Me estoy perdiendo algo obvio, o está relacionado con el...

158
¿Cómo se sale de una función vacía en C ++?

¿Cómo puede salir prematuramente de una función sin devolver un valor si es una función nula? Tengo un método nulo que no necesita ejecutar su código si cierta condición es verdadera. Realmente no quiero tener que cambiar el método para devolver un

158
Generando entero aleatorio a partir de un rango

Necesito una función que genere un número entero aleatorio en un rango determinado (incluidos los valores de borde). No tengo requisitos de calidad / aleatoriedad irracionales, tengo cuatro requisitos: Necesito que sea rápido. Mi proyecto necesita generar millones (o incluso decenas de millones)...

158
Variables estáticas en funciones miembro

¿Alguien puede explicar cómo funcionan las variables estáticas en las funciones miembro en C ++? Dada la siguiente clase: class A { void foo() { static int i; i++; } } Si declaro varias instancias de A, ¿llamar foo()a una instancia incrementa la variable estática ien todas las instancias?...

157
Herencia de C ++: ¿base inaccesible?

Parece que no puedo usar una clase base como parámetro de función, ¿he estropeado mi herencia? Tengo lo siguiente en mi principal: int some_ftn(Foo *f) { /* some code */ }; Bar b; some_ftn(&b); Y la clase Bar hereda de Foo de tal manera: class Bar : Foo { public: Bar(); //snip private:...

157
Mover captura en lambda

¿Cómo capturo por movimiento (también conocido como referencia de valor) en una lambda C ++ 11? Estoy tratando de escribir algo como esto: std::unique_ptr<int> myPointer(new int); std::function<void(void)> example = [std::move(myPointer)]{ *myPointer =

157
printf con std :: string?

Entiendo que stringes un miembro del stdespacio de nombres, entonces, ¿por qué ocurre lo siguiente? #include <iostream> int main() { using namespace std; string myString = "Press ENTER to quit program!"; cout << "Come up and C++ me some time." << endl; printf("Follow this...